Australia announce playing XI for first Ashes Test

0 146

Cricket fans across the globe are gearing up for the relishing Ashes series which will be held from 8 December. In that context, the Australian Cricket Board has announced their playing XI for the first Ashes test against England. Pat Cummins will captain Australia for the first time.

Wicket-keeper Alex Carey to make his test debut and Australia will be playing with three main fast bowlers in the likes of Mitchell Starc, Cummins and Josh Hazlewood.

Australia XI- Marcus Harris, David Warner, Marnus Labuschagne, Steve Smith, Travis Head, Cameron Green, Alex Carey (wk), Pat Cummins (c), Mitch Starc, Nathan Lyon, Josh Hazlewood.
